About This Episode:
👉 Every time you type a URL, click a link, or submit a form, your server has to decide: what happens next? That’s where routing comes in.
💥 In this video, we’ll break down Routing Basics in Node.js and learn how servers handle requests:
- How URLs, HTTP methods (GET, POST), and headers guide server responses.
- Writing simple routes to serve different pages (Home, About, Contact).
- Handling form submissions with POST requests.
- Returning JSON vs. HTML based on client preferences ⚡️.
🤖 By the end, you’ll understand how to map requests to responses — the foundation for building APIs, web apps, and more.
